Home Foundations: Understanding Your Options
Noon, Apr. 22
Curious about home foundation types suitable for Maine homebuilding? Home foundations are a significant cost driver when building a new home, and each foundation type has its pros and cons. Explore the features and performance of 7+ foundation types during a moderated panel discussion with industry professionals including Alan Gibson, Principal of GO Logic; Ryan MacEachern, Owner of Maker Construction; and our very own Steve Eaton, Vice President of Operations for Zero Energy Homes.
Specific foundation types we’ll cover include full basements, slabs, insulated concrete form (ICF) foundations, helical piles, and more. The webinar will conclude with a Q&A session.
